Performance of Village Credit Instituion (LPD) of DemayuSingakerta Village Ubud District Gianyar Regency The Village Credit Institution (LPD) of Demayu is an institution that plays a role inthe economy of the Indigenous Village of Demayu and as one of the financialinstitutions in rural agriculture. The development and progress of Village CreditInstitutions can be seen through some of the performance namely the financial andthe management performances. The purpose of the study was to determine thefinancial performance by using the profit-oriented ratio of financial institutions andthe management performance of the Village Credit Institution (LPD) of Demayu interms of internal and external aspects. The analytical method used to assess thefinancial performance was conducted by using profit-oriented ratio analysis offinancial institutions while the assessment of the management performance can beseen from two aspects, i.e. the internal and the external performances. Internalperformance can be analyzed from the employee satisfaction aspect and the externalperformance can be seen from the customer satisfaction aspect as measured by Likertscale. Based on the findings of the research, it can be concluded that the VillageCredit Institution (LPD) of Demayu financial performance evaluated from currentratio, debt to asset ratio, total asset turnover were in very unfit category, while the netprofit margin was fit. The management performance in terms of internal aspectobtained an overall average score of 3,97% that categorized as satisfied while theperformance of management in terms of external aspects obtained an overall averagescore of 4.09% that is also categorized as satisfied . Suggestions that can be given:the Village Credit Institution (LPD) of Demayu should further foster their owncapital so that assets increase without increasing the debt; one of them is by way ofincreasing credit distribution activities to the community, for performancemanagement in terms of internal aspects, the management should more oftencommunicate and interact with employees, for the management performance viewedfrom the external aspect, the management should pay more attention and improve thequality of service, and every activity carried out on the Village Credit Institution(LPD) of Demayu should be more emphasized on the concept of Tri Hita Karana.

The Realization of Agricultural Machinery Aid To Subak(Implementation Case of Special Effort Program Enhancement of RiceCorn and Soybeans Production in Subak Penginyahan, Puhu Village ofPayangan District, Gianyar) Indonesia is one of agricultural country and most of the citizen work in agriculturesector but in some recent years Indonesia always import food from other countries, toprevent this from happening continuously in 2015, the government makes a specialeffort progarm (Upsus) enhancement of rice, corn, and soybeans production in 2017is expected that Indonesia has reached food self-sufficiency, Upsus program hassome kind of aids like agricultural equipment and machine aid (Alsintan) that isexpected to simplify and speed up the production process.This study aims to find out(1) To find out the suitability of the proposed agricultural machinery aid (Alsintan)proposed by Subak Penginyahan; (2) To find out the use of agricultural machinerywhich is Subak Penginyahan recieved.The location of this research is located inSubak Penginyahan, Puhu Village, Payangan District, Gianyar Regency. Populationof this research is 70 active members of Subak Penginyahan. Sample size wasdetermined using Nottoadmojo formula, so the number of respondents who weretaken 41 people and added with 1 respondent from Agriculture Department ofGianyar Regency, 1 PPL respondent who in charge at Penginyahan Subak and 1respondent from Pekaseh Subak Penginyahan.The result of this study indicates thatthe realization of Alsintan aid in Subak Penginyahan is not suitable as purposed.There are differences in numbers and types of Alsintan that is proposed with receivedby Subak. For Alsintan type received by Subak is alsintan hand tractor type with thisthe realization of Alsintan aid that is purposed by Subak is suitable with what isproposed by Subak. Based on findings of the research that the writer conducted, itcan be suggested to the government to increase its attention to the farmercontinuously; In this case to continue aids provision that could help and provoke theenthusiasm of farmers to farm.

Determination of Groundwater Prices for Sustainable Irrigation in JembranaRegency Subak Babakan Yehkuning is relatively new in obtaining Groundwater IrrigationNetwork, with the code YKN-127 in 2014. This study aims to determine the costcomponents and water prices that reflect the value of water use in a sustainablemanner. The method used in this research is quantitative calculation. The total waterdischarge from YKN-127 for three planting seasons in September 2015 until August2016 consecutively was 83,647.01 m3. This amount was derived from the total life ofthe pump for 2,733 hours, with a discharge 8.5 liters/second. The commoditiescultivated in three planting seasons were rice for two times and secondary crop (cornand soybean). Since the availability of ground water has a limited amount, it isimportant to note that the amount of water use should be less than the availabilities.The concept of sustainable value in the use of water is consisted of the total cost ofsupply, opportunity costs, and externalities costs. The results showed that the waterprice reflecting the sustainable water use value for irrigation at YKN-127 was Rp3,933.91/m3, which consisted of a full supply cost 65.9% (Rp 2,592.42/m3), anopportunity cost 27.9% (Rp 1,099.43/m3), and depletion premium 6.2% (Rp242.06/m3). This result is almost three times the operational and maintenance coststhat farmers usually pay for Rp 1,633.99/m3. This price describes the value that mustbe paid as an effort to maintain the development of irrigated agriculture sector andground water resources in order to remain sustainable in Jembrana, Bali Province.

Subak of Jatiluwih Interaction with Tourism Jatiluwih is well known as a world-recognized agricultural and tourism area. Thiscondition reflects a good interaction between agriculture which in this case isrepresented by subak/organization of irrigation with tourism i.e. is represented bytourism actors. Data collection in the field shows different conditions, namely thefinding of land conversion and job transformation from subak members. Both ofthese conditions indicate an interaction between subak and tourism actors. Thepurpose of the study discusses the form of interaction between subak with tourism inJatiluwih, and the impact of interaction on the existence of subak. The analyticalmethod used to discuss the research problem is descriptive qualitative analysis.Qualitative descriptions are applied to information provided by the subak membersand tourism stakeholders. The findings showed that associative interaction was moreprominent than the dissociative interaction. Cooperation of Subak Jatiluwih withtourism in the permission of utilizing the subak area for the agency management ofJatiluwih Tourism Destination Area is meant to be the generator income because ofits natural beauty. In contrast, Subak Jatiluwih needs for compensation for anydamages to rice field and fund for religious ceremony of subak, namely theceremony of Ngusaba Ayu and fund for cleaning the subak irrigation channel. Thedissociative interaction can still be declared low because it can still be wellanticipated. Suggestions that can be given that the contribution to the subak need tobe considered for the subak given a more feasible contribution because it isconsidered so far not meet the feasible criteria.

Farmers Perception Of Options To Sell Rice Penebas Or Perpadi(especially in Subak Benel, Kaliakah Village, Negara districts,Jembrana Regency) Various efforts have been implemented by the Provincial Food Crops Agency of Balito stabilize the price of grain, this is done by giving Funds of Rural EconomicEmpowerment Capital to the government for the purchase of rice. Although it hasbeen done from 2003, farmers are still selling it to Penebas with a bondage system.The purpose of this study to determine the perception of farmers to the choice ofselling rice to Perpadi or Penebas seen and differences in farmers' perceptions of thechoice of selling rice to Penebas or Perpadi. The research location is located in SubakBenel, Kaliakah Village, State District, Jembrana District. The analytical methodused is qualitative descriptive that aided with score, to answer the purpose ofresearch by using questionnaire. The results of this study indicate that the perceptionof farmers to the choice of selling rice to Perpadi better than to Penebas. This is seenin the achievement of the farmers' choice of selling paddy to Perpadi is very goodand to Penebas is good. The difference of Perpadi with Penebas is measured throughDifferent Test with SPSS Independent Sample T test program which the result of Sigvalue. Or p value of 0.004 where <0.05 then there is a statistically significantdifference in probability 0.05, the mean difference or mean of both groups is shownin Mean Difference ie .29559.

Perception of Young Generations’ Interest in Farming in Tanah LotTourism Area (The Case of Subak Gadon III, Tabanan) The rapid development of tourism will affect subak : that is, the transformation oflabor, the occurrence of land conversion, and the occurrence of water usecompetition. Tourism will have an impact on farming interest, especially the youngergeneration of farm households in Subak Gadon III, knowing that this subak is locatedin the tourism area. The purpose of this study was to analyze perceptions anddifferences in the perception of younger generation of non-tourism and youngergeneration of tourism about the impact of tourism on farming interest of the youngergeneration of farm households in Subak Gadon III, Tabanan. Data analysis methodused was descriptive-qualitative and quantitative.The results showed that the perception of the younger generation of non-tourismabout the impact of tourism on the farming interest of the younger generation wasclassified with a score of 3,32. The younger generation of non-tourism had aperception that the existence of tourism sufficiently influenced the farming interest ofthe young generation, but it did not make the non-tourism youth switch to tourism.The younger generation of tourism showed that tourism had a high impact on theinterest of farming the younger generation with a score of 3,55. The younggeneration of tourism has a perception that tourism was the most appropriate choicebecause for them the tourism sector is very supportive of its life. There is adifference in the impact of tourism on farming interest in the younger generation ofnon-tourism and young generation of farm households' tourism in Subak Gadon III,Beraban, Tabanan. This difference was seen in 3 parameters of a total of 14parameters.Suggestions that can be made for this research are for Subak Gadon III in the futureto be able to initiate a new breakthrough by involving the young generation invarious activities in subak life to attract farmers especially the younger generation offarm households in Subak Gadon III, Tabanan.

Correlation Between Farmer Characteristic With Their Motivation In CultivateA Sugar Cane (In Case Of Dewi Ratih 1 Farmer Group At Maospati Village,Subdistrict Of Maospati, Magetan Regency) Sugar cane plant plays an important role in meeting the sugar consumtion needs ofsociety and industrial sector. In order to support the improvement of sugar cane plantproduction, the government should provide an input or direction that is needed bysugar cane farmers as a motivation for farmers to increase the production of sugarcane as a raw material for sugar. The characteristics of the farmers have become oneof important factors that affect the farmer motivation in cultivation of sugar caneplant in farmer’s group of Dewi Ratih 1, Maospati Village, Maospati Districts,Magetan Regency. Which is expected to be a reference for the government and thefarmers in determine the policies and development strategies in order to make sugarcane farming can improve revenue and the welfare of the farmers. The purpose ofthis research is to identify the characteristics of the farmer, motivation of the farmersin cultivating sugar cane plant and determine the correlation between the farmerscharacteristics and the farmer motivation in cultivating sugar cane plant in farmer’sgroup of Dewi Ratih 1, Maospati village, Maospati districts, Magetan regency. Thissampling by using simple random method. Data analysis method that is used isdescriptive analysis and spearman rank correlation coefficient test. The result ofdescriptive analysis shows that the farmers characteristics included in the lowcategory, while the farmer motivation in cultivation of sugar cane plant included inthe medium category. The result of spearman rank correlation analysis shows that thecharacteristics of the farmers who have a significant correlation with the motivationof the farmers is age, household income, vast of arable land, the number ofhousehold members, and farming experience.

Farmer Behavior towards the Program of Gerbang Pangan Serasi (A Case atIrrigation Organization of Subak Tajen, Village of Tajen, Penebel Sub-District,Regency of Tabanan) Continuous use of inorganic fertilizer for a long time has had a negative impact onsoil and the environment. In order to maintain the existence of the agricultural sectorand to implement the efforts towards organic agriculture, the local government ofTabanan Regency established a flagship program called the Gerbang Pangan Serasi(GPS) Program. This study aims to determine the behavior of farmers towards theGerbang Pangan Serasi (GPS) Program, which is measured from the level ofknowledge, attitude, and skills. The research was conducted in Subak Tajen, TajenVillage, Penebel Sub-District, Tabanan Regency. The selection of research site wasdone purposively. The population was the Subak Tajen members who received theGerbang Pangan Serasi (GPS) Program as many as 34 people. With the censustechnique, 12 farmers who received the aid of cattle were taken as respondents, plus12 farmers who did not receive the aid of cattle. Thus, the total number ofrespondents was 24 people. Based on the findings of the research, it is known that thebehavior of farmers who received the aid of cattle towards the Gerbang PanganSerasi Program is good category, with knowledge score of 3,91, attitude score of4,08 and skill score of 4,82. Whereas, the behavior of farmers who did not receivethe aid of cattle was in moderate category, with the knowledge score of 3,01, attitudescore of 3,69 and skill of 2,78. Thus, the behavior of farmers who received cattleassistance is categorized as good category with the score of 3.94 and the behavior offarmers who did not get the aid of cattle is classified as moderate category with thescore 3.35. Based on the findings, it is suggested to farmers that they should bewilling to apply technology and innovation in the field of agriculture provided byextension workers, because the farmers will get new experiences to be applied intheir farming.

Analysis of Red Chili Trading System in Besakih Village, Rendang Sub-Districtof Karangasem Regency Besakih village as one of the centers of red chilli production in Karangasem Regencyhas several marketing channels with different prices between producers andconsumers. This study aims to investigate the channels of trading, commercialinstitutions, and the red chili trading system in the Village of Besakih. The data usedwere quantitative and qualitative data. The analysis used descriptive qualitative.Respondents in the study were 38 farmers determined by proportional randomsampling method and 23 respondents of trading institutions determined by snowballsampling method. The research result was six channels of trading system, (1)Farmers – Local Assembly Trader’s - Retailers - Consumers; (2) Farmers - LocalAssembly Trader’s - Retailers - Consumers; (3) Farmers – Sub Terminal ofAgribusiness - Retailers - Consumers; (4) Farmers - Sub Terminal of Agribusiness -Retailers - Consumers; (5) Farmers - Sub Terminal of Agribusiness - Consumers; (6)Farmers - Sub Terminal of Agribusiness – Market in Lombok. The most efficienttrading channel was channel II. The trading agency consists of local assemblytrader’s / inter-city / inter-district traders, Sub Terminal of Agribusiness / inter-city /inter-district / inter island traders, traditional market retailers and supermarketretailers. Each of the trading system institution involved the three main functions ofexchange, physical function and facility function. However, the activities undertakenby each institution were different.
